Detailed Specs & Features Explained
On paper, Staples' offering spans multiple print product categories such as Photo Prints, Canvas Prints, Wall Art, Cards, and Calendars. This broad range means users aren't limited to basic photo prints but can venture into decorative and professional-grade prints with ease. The service supports a dual ordering platform via both web browsers and in-store kiosks, significantly widening accessibility across devices, including mobile, as backed by their mobile app presence. The printing specifications include high print resolution with a hybrid color technology deploying both dye and pigment inks, which typically enhances color vibrancy and longevity. Utilizing varied paper materials such as photo paper and canvas with finishes in glossy or matte provides users with options suited to multiple aesthetic preferences.
However, archival quality is absent, and the fade resistance rating is medium, meaning that while prints won't fade immediately, long-term preservation for high-value or heirloom pieces might require additional care. When it comes to size and format, Staples supports popular options like 4x6, 5x7, 8x10, and up to custom sizes with a maximum print width of 36 inches and height of 48 inches, unlocking possibilities for larger wall art or panoramic shots. They even offer borderless printing and formats suited to square or panoramic images, adding creative flexibility often appreciated by artists and decorators.
User Experience & Performance
Design & Build
In daily use, Staples Online Photo Printing shows strong design considerations aligned with user convenience. The service supports file upload and drag & drop (though user drag-and-drop upload on the platform itself is marked as No), making it straightforward for users to upload images from local devices and mobile phones. The absence of cloud storage integration is a slight drawback for those who heavily rely on cloud platforms. However, batch upload and reorder from history simplify frequent or bulk ordering, which is crucial for business clients or event-based bulk printing.
Performance
What makes this service notable is the combination of high print resolution and hybrid color technology that should result in rich and clear images. The use of dye and pigment inks enhances the depth of color, aided by a variable gloss level and smooth surface texture, creating prints that feel polished and professional. Despite medium fade resistance, the inclusion of smudge resistance adds durability for casual handling, especially with photo paper and canvas products. The service lacks water resistance but compensates somewhat through lamination options, including both glossy and matte finishes, which protect prints in daily use.
Extra Features
Staples delivers several customization tools within its platform, including an online editor with cropping, rotating, color correction, text overlays, and templates. Auto enhancement features are also available, streamlining adjustments for users who are less comfortable with photo editing. However, the absence of red-eye removal or sticker/graphic libraries limits creative or corrective options for certain photo finishing tasks. On turnaround time, Staples offers standard production of 1-3 business days alongside rush options and even same-day printing, which is excellent for last-minute printing needs.

Price & Value for Money
While the precise pricing is not provided here except for a base reference of $11 at Staples.com, assessing its value against specifications reveals a well-rounded platform. Given its standard production time of 1-3 business days, combined with rush and same-day printing options, plus the extensive print quality and satisfaction guarantees, Staples delivers justified pricing for both casual and professional users. The printed materials offer a blend of quality and versatility backed by moderate durability, which aligns with typical market expectations for mid-tier online photo printers. That said, users requiring archival-grade permanence or advanced workflow integrations might find better options elsewhere.
